Now on view through March 30 at Walnut Creek’s Bedford Gallery is[*Stitched: Contemporary Embroidery*](https://bit.ly/3Q9rm6r?ref=hyperallergic.com). The exhibition offers a deep dive into contemporary embroidery practices and encourages visitors to experience embroidery as more than decorative craftwork by revealing its historical depth and contemporary relevance. By merging traditional embroidery techniques with innovative approaches and social/political themes, the artists in this exhibition strive to create powerful narratives that challenge outdated perceptions and elevate textile art to new heights.

The artists featured in the exhibition include Rosemarie Beck, Kim Bennett, Sarah K. Benning, Natalie Ciccoricco, Lucia Engstrom, Elsa Hansen Oldham, Caroline Harrius, Liz Harvey, Nneka Jones, Michelle Kingdom, Lisa Kokin, Stacey Lee Webber, Sophia Narrett, Matthew Pawlowski, Bonnie Peterson, Olga Prinku, Roz Ritter, José Romussi, and Elliot Schultz.

*Stitched: Contemporary Embroidery* will remain on view through March 30 at [Bedford Gallery](https://bit.ly/3WT90u2?ref=hyperallergic.com) inside the Lesher Center for the Arts, 12 to 5pm, Wednesdays through Sundays.
